Mar 19, 2019 · "You betcha" is typically heard in the American Upper Midwest, 1 but perhaps some people outside of that region also use the phrase. Its meaning is essentially the same as the more common "you bet." Both are used to mean, yes or definitely. As with all replies to "thank you," it doesn't have meaning beyond a friendly acknowledgment of the thanks. In other words, it has the exact same meaning ...

"Betcha" is short for "bet you" which is used to show that you are certain or confident about something being true. Ex: I betcha tomorrow they will be sold out. "Betcha" can have a different meaning when used in the expression "you betcha". This is another way of saying "yes" or "sure". Ex: "Can I have some water?" "You betcha!"
